Flight Chaos Strands Passengers at CFB Goose Bay

Weather Turbulence Cascades Into Remote Hub

The disruption at CFB Goose Bay comes amid a broader spell of late-season winter weather affecting large parts of Canada, where snow, freezing rain, and gusty winds have complicated operations at both major hubs and smaller regional airports. Publicly available flight-tracking data and national flight boards for early April indicate elevated levels of delays and cancellations across the country as storm systems sweep through Atlantic and central Canada.

In Goose Bay, a key lifeline for Labrador communities, the impact is magnified by the airport’s limited daily schedule and the reliance on a small number of carriers. When a handful of rotations are pushed back or scrubbed, the result is a sharp reduction in available seats and a rapid build-up of stranded passengers in the terminal.

Operational data for regional airlines suggest that weather-related ground holds at larger hubs can quickly ripple outward to remote stations such as Goose Bay. Aircraft and crews scheduled to operate Labrador routes are often based in cities like St. John’s and Halifax; when those airports slow down, downstream departures from Goose Bay are forced into rolling delays or cancellations.

For travelers, that has meant extended waits in departure lounges, missed connections further south, and an uptick in rebookings as carriers shuffle limited capacity across their networks.

Air Borealis and PAL Airlines Bear the Brunt

The bulk of the disruption at CFB Goose Bay is concentrated among Air Borealis and PAL Airlines, the two carriers that provide much of the scheduled service linking Labrador with Newfoundland and the rest of Atlantic Canada. Publicly available airline schedules show that both operators run multiple daily services touching Goose Bay, including links onward to St. John’s, Halifax, and Montreal.

On the affected day, eight departures and arrivals connected to Goose Bay were reported delayed, with holds ranging from modest schedule slippages to multi-hour setbacks. Six additional flights were cancelled outright, removing critical capacity on routes that typically see modest frequencies even under normal conditions.

According to published coverage of Canada’s early April weather disruptions, PAL Airlines and partner operators have already been managing a difficult month, with earlier storms triggering a series of cancellations and delays across Newfoundland and Labrador and neighboring provinces. The latest issues at Goose Bay add further strain, as aircraft and crews cycle through maintenance and duty-time constraints after repeated schedule upheavals.

With Air Borealis and PAL focused heavily on community routes, each lost sector represents more than just a missed business connection. Many passengers rely on these flights for medical appointments, education travel, and essential supply movements, raising the stakes when irregular operations persist for several days.

Ripple Effects to St. John’s, Halifax, Montreal, and Toronto

The grounding of multiple flights at Goose Bay has had consequences well beyond Labrador. Published aviation analytics for early April show that major hubs including St. John’s, Halifax, and Montreal were already contending with weather-related pressures, while Toronto Pearson recorded some of the country’s highest disruption totals.

As Goose Bay flights into these cities run late or are cancelled, connecting passengers can miss onward departures to national and international destinations. A delayed Goose Bay to Halifax service, for instance, can strand travelers booked onward to Toronto, while scrubbed Goose Bay to St. John’s rotations may break connections to Montreal and beyond.

Once connection windows are missed, rebooking options are limited. Seat availability on subsequent departures is often constrained during peak travel periods, especially when earlier storms have already pushed a backlog of displaced passengers into later flights. Reports from national travel outlets describe travelers across Canada facing similar patterns of rolling delays, repeated rebookings, and longer-than-expected journeys.

These knock-on effects can persist even after local weather improves. Airlines must reposition aircraft and crews, clear maintenance backlogs, and work through accumulated passenger demand, meaning that regional stations like Goose Bay can experience lingering irregularities long after the worst of the storm has passed.

Stranded Passengers Face Long Waits and Limited Alternatives

For those caught in the disruption at CFB Goose Bay, options are limited. Unlike larger urban centers, alternative transport modes are scarce, and overland routes can be slow or impractical in winter conditions. When multiple flights are delayed or cancelled in quick succession, accommodations and local services in the Happy Valley–Goose Bay area can quickly reach capacity.

Publicly available information from consumer advocacy and travel-compensation organizations notes that Canadian aviation regulations provide certain protections for passengers, but the applicability of compensation can depend on whether disruptions are categorized as weather-related or within an airline’s control. In severe winter conditions, many cancellations are classified as safety-driven, reducing eligibility for financial redress even as travelers face significant inconvenience.

Travel industry guidance emphasizes the importance of monitoring airline apps and airport departure boards, particularly in smaller markets where schedule changes may be posted close to departure time. In Goose Bay, where a single cancelled rotation can erase an entire day’s direct connectivity on a given route, same-day alternatives are often unavailable, increasing the likelihood of overnight stays.

Local observers note that the current situation underscores just how exposed remote communities are to swings in the national aviation system. When irregular operations sweep through the country, smaller airports with fewer daily flights can quickly become pressure points, with passengers bearing the brunt of a network stretched thin.
